当先锋百科网

首页 1 2 3 4 5 6 7

在网页设计中,CSS背景色的使用非常重要。它可以为网页添加色彩和深度。但是,有时候我们发现,背景色并没有填满整个屏幕,而是只填充了页面的一部分。那么,我们应该如何解决这个问题呢?

body {
background-color: red;
height: 100vh; /* 设置高度为视窗高度 */
}

解决这个问题的方法是通过CSS的height属性来设置高度。具体来说,我们可以使用height: 100vh; 将背景色的高度设置为视窗的高度。这样,无论网页内容有多长,背景色都会一直填满整个屏幕。但是,需要注意的是,这种方法只适用于全屏背景色。

当然,如果你需要为网页的其他元素添加背景色,你可以将高度设置为相应元素的高度。例如:

.header {
background-color: blue;
height: 60px; /* 设置高度为60像素 */
}

总的来说,通过设置CSS的height属性,我们可以轻松地实现背景色始终填满整个屏幕的效果。这种方法简单易用,可以为网页设计带来更好的外观和用户体验。